I have created an experimental web service on the Jorne site. It uses
Robin's PEG parser to create an XML parse tree based on Lojban text.
It's not particularly tolerant of errors in the text - did I mention
experimental? ;-) - and the output tree is not much to look at. Its
purpose is not to be displayed directly, but to embed within
Javascript calls for Lojban mashups.
There is a web form that you can use to see how the service works.
http://jorne.org/form.jsp
The easiest way to build something on the XML result is to apply an
XSL stylesheet that does some highlighting or text outlining. You are
welcome to call the service from your own web site as long as it
doesn't overwhelm the service with too many calls. I plan to make a
stylesheet to pretty-print something better when I have some time.
